Newark Street looking south from Philip Street, Bath 1969

Newark Street looking south from Philip Street, Bath 1969

Image Reference: 28191
Image Date: 1969
Measurements: 5.5 x 6.7 cm
Medium: photo
Collection: Bath Chronicle
Library Reference: P8140 AX270/2
Credit: Bath & North East Somerset Council
Library: Bath Record Office : Archives & Local Studies

Description: The entrance to Marchant's Passage can be seen on the right. In the distance is Hughes Brothers and the Edinburgh Castle pub.
Photographed in January 1969.
